Recipe preparation

Essential Ingredients

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Boneless, Skinless Chicken Breasts: Opt for 3-4 breasts for ample servings; grilled or roasted works wonders.
  • Fresh Corn: Sweet corn enhances the salad’s texture; fresh is best when in season.
  • Black Beans: Canned black beans save time; rinse them well to reduce sodium content.
  • Cherry Tomatoes: These juicy gems add color and sweetness; slice them in half for a burst of flavor.
  • Red Onion: Use finely diced red onion for that sharp bite; soak in water briefly to mellow the flavor if desired.
  • Avocado: Ripe avocados bring creaminess; choose ones with dark skin that yield slightly when pressed.
  • Cilantro: Fresh cilantro elevates the flavor profile; chop roughly for an aromatic finish.
  • Lime Juice: Freshly squeezed lime juice adds zesty brightness; don’t skimp on this essential ingredient!
  • Southwest Seasoning Blend: Use your favorite blend or mix cumin, paprika, and chili powder for a kick.
  • Olive Oil: A drizzle of olive oil helps meld all the flavors together beautifully.

Let’s Make it Together

Cook the Chicken: Start by preheating your grill or oven to medium heat. Season the chicken breasts with southwest seasoning and a splash of olive oil. Grill or roast until cooked through, about 15-20 minutes.

Prepare the Veggies: While the chicken cooks, chop your veggies—diced tomatoes, corn kernels, black beans (drained), red onion, avocado, and cilantro—all ready for mixing.

Create the Dressing: In a small bowl, whisk together lime juice and remaining olive oil. Add salt and pepper to taste; this simple dressing is key to bringing everything together.

Toss It All Together: Once the chicken has cooled slightly, dice it into bite-sized pieces. In a large bowl, combine all ingredients gently so you don’t squish the avocado.

Serve and Enjoy!: Transfer your vibrant salad to a serving platter or individual bowls. Garnish with extra cilantro if you’re feeling fancy. Enjoy immediately or refrigerate for up to 30 minutes to let those flavors meld even further.

Storing & Reheating

Store the salad in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. To maintain freshness, avoid adding dressing until ready to serve.

Zesty Southwest Chicken Salad


  • Author: homerecipeseasy
  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 6

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 cup fresh corn kernels
  • 1 can (15 oz) black beans, rinsed and drained
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• ½ medium red onion, finely diced
  • 2 ripe avocados, diced
  • ½ cup fresh cilantro, chopped
  • Juice of 2 limes
  • 2 tsp southwest seasoning blend (cumin, paprika, chili powder)
  • 2 tbsp olive oil

Instructions

  1. Preheat the grill or oven to medium heat. Season chicken with southwest seasoning and olive oil. Cook for 15-20 minutes until fully cooked. Let cool slightly before dicing.
  2. While the chicken cooks, chop the corn, black beans, tomatoes, onion, avocados, and cilantro.
  3. In a small bowl, whisk lime juice with remaining olive oil; season with salt and pepper.
  4. In a large bowl, gently combine all ingredients including diced chicken.
  5. Serve in a platter or individual bowls; garnish with extra cilantro if desired.
